About Style is Spirit™

Developed in San Francisco in 2016 through interdisciplinary workshops on personal style, confidence, and wellbeing, Style Is Spirit™ has grown into Sohocolab’s signature observation-based methodology.

RESET draws on environmental psychology and systems thinking to help individuals and organizations understand how their surroundings shape everyday experience, not just how things look, but how they function, how they feel, and how well they serve the people who use them.

The Reset Framework

Every RESET begins with observation.

We look beyond appearance to understand how people interact with their environments. 

Our approach follows six guiding principles:

Observe - Notice behaviors, routines, and patterns.

Understand - Identify strengths and points of friction.

Reveal - Discover opportunities that often remain hidden.

Reimagine - Explore practical possibilities before replacing.

Refine - Improve function, flow, and everyday experience.

RESET - Create environments that better support people while encouraging thoughtful reuse, repair, repurposing, and responsible resource use.

Every engagement includes the Style Is Spirit™ | RESET Workbook, providing practical exercises, observations, and a personalised action plan.
